Grand Theft Auto IV: The Complete Edition

Grand Theft Auto IV: The Complete Edition

View Stats:
First person mod not activating
I can't get the first person mod to work. I have dsound.dll and scripthook.dll. What is wrong?
< >
Showing 1-7 of 7 comments
ciggie May 22, 2017 @ 7:00pm 
you need AdvancedHook.dll and ScriptHookDotNet.dll
Last edited by ciggie; May 22, 2017 @ 7:00pm
captainnick14 May 23, 2017 @ 5:01am 
Originally posted by XLVII:
you need AdvancedHook.dll and ScriptHookDotNet.dll

I don't remember needing those files. It wasn't in the description for the mod. Why do I need them? Specifically the advanced hook.dll. I haven't played this game for 2 months because the mods were giving me trouble.
Last edited by captainnick14; May 23, 2017 @ 5:02am
hs May 23, 2017 @ 5:16am 
i think it is because your game version is upgraded to 1080 downgrade game to 1070 or 1040
or maybe faulty of dsound? try to use xlive instead of dsound
if it doesn't work, should install vc++ 2005~2015 / dotnet 4.6.2
Last edited by hs; May 23, 2017 @ 5:26am
captainnick14 May 23, 2017 @ 4:30pm 
I found some text files in the rot directory.

Log start: Tue May 23 19:18:54 2017
-----------------------------------------------
[INFO] GTA IV Script Hook 0.3.0 - (C) 2009, Aru - Initialized
[INFO] Process base address: 0x1190000
[INFO] Auto detecting game version
[FATAL] Failed to detect game version


// -- GTA IV ASI LOADER LOG -- //
//-- (C) Alexander Blade 2008 -- //
C:\WINDOWS\system32\dsound.dll is loaded, address 0x592B0000
Hooking dsound proc named "DirectSoundCreate"
"DirectSoundCreate" hooked, address 0x592F66E0
Hooking dsound proc named "DirectSoundEnumerateA"
"DirectSoundEnumerateA" hooked, address 0x5930F0A0
Hooking dsound proc named "DirectSoundEnumerateW"
"DirectSoundEnumerateW" hooked, address 0x5930F0C0
Hooking dsound proc named "DllCanUnloadNow"
"DllCanUnloadNow" hooked, address 0x592F73D0
Hooking dsound proc named "DllGetClassObject"
"DllGetClassObject" hooked, address 0x592F0730
Hooking dsound proc named "DirectSoundCaptureCreate"
"DirectSoundCaptureCreate" hooked, address 0x5930EFA0
Hooking dsound proc named "DirectSoundCaptureEnumerateA"
"DirectSoundCaptureEnumerateA" hooked, address 0x5930F060
Hooking dsound proc named "DirectSoundCaptureEnumerateW"
"DirectSoundCaptureEnumerateW" hooked, address 0x5930F080
Hooking dsound proc named "GetDeviceID"
"GetDeviceID" hooked, address 0x5930F3B0
Hooking dsound proc named "DirectSoundFullDuplexCreate"
"DirectSoundFullDuplexCreate" hooked, address 0x5930F0E0
Hooking dsound proc named "DirectSoundCreate8"
"DirectSoundCreate8" hooked, address 0x592FC270
Hooking dsound proc named "DirectSoundCaptureCreate8"
"DirectSoundCaptureCreate8" hooked, address 0x5930EED0
Loading ASI C:\Program Files (x86)\Steam\steamapps\common\Grand Theft Auto IV\GTAIV\FirstPerson.asi
ASI loaded : C:\Program Files (x86)\Steam\steamapps\common\Grand Theft Auto IV\GTAIV\FirstPerson.asi, Address 0x00000000
Loading ASI C:\Program Files (x86)\Steam\steamapps\common\Grand Theft Auto IV\GTAIV\ScriptHookDotNet.asi
ASI loaded : C:\Program Files (x86)\Steam\steamapps\common\Grand Theft Auto IV\GTAIV\ScriptHookDotNet.asi, Address 0x00000000
Loading ASI C:\Program Files (x86)\Steam\steamapps\common\Grand Theft Auto IV\GTAIV\Skorpro SafeHouses - GTA IV.asi
ASI loaded : C:\Program Files (x86)\Steam\steamapps\common\Grand Theft Auto IV\GTAIV\Skorpro SafeHouses - GTA IV.asi, Address 0x00000000
Loading ASI C:\Program Files (x86)\Steam\steamapps\common\Grand Theft Auto IV\GTAIV\Trainer.asi
ASI loaded : C:\Program Files (x86)\Steam\steamapps\common\Grand Theft Auto IV\GTAIV\Trainer.asi, Address 0x00000000
Loading ASI C:\Program Files (x86)\Steam\steamapps\common\Grand Theft Auto IV\GTAIV\Trainertbogt.asi
ASI loaded : C:\Program Files (x86)\Steam\steamapps\common\Grand Theft Auto IV\GTAIV\Trainertbogt.asi, Address 0x00000000
Loading ASI C:\Program Files (x86)\Steam\steamapps\common\Grand Theft Auto IV\GTAIV\Trainertlad.asi
ASI loaded : C:\Program Files (x86)\Steam\steamapps\common\Grand Theft Auto IV\GTAIV\Trainertlad.asi, Address 0x00000000

2017-05-23 18:30:54 - Initializing ScriptHookDotNet v1.7.1.7 BETA (on GTA IV version 1.0.7.0 with C++ Hook version 0.5.1)



Log start: Tue May 23 17:52:19 2017
-----------------------------------------------
[INFO] GTA IV Script Hook 0.3.0c - Initialized
[INFO] Process base address: 0xd60000
[INFO] Using game version 3.0.1
[INFO] Awaiting game thread creation
[INFO] Script Hook - Shutdown

This is for the first person mod.
Could this be of any use?
captainnick14 May 24, 2017 @ 4:01pm 
I've uninstalled and reinstalled the game and deleted all mods and files like scripthook and all the other files. The game is running version 7. I will follow the first person mod instructions. Maybe this will help.


EDIT

Found these text files. It seems something stops working.


FirstPerson.ini
FirstPerson.asi
xlive_d.dll
xlive.dll
ScriptHook.dll
ScriptHookDotNet.asi



// -- GTA IV ASI LOADER LOG -- //
//-- (C) Alexander Blade 2008 -- //
C:\WINDOWS\system32\dsound.dll is loaded, address 0x592B0000
Hooking dsound proc named "DirectSoundCreate"
"DirectSoundCreate" hooked, address 0x592F66E0
Hooking dsound proc named "DirectSoundEnumerateA"
"DirectSoundEnumerateA" hooked, address 0x5930F0A0
Hooking dsound proc named "DirectSoundEnumerateW"
"DirectSoundEnumerateW" hooked, address 0x5930F0C0
Hooking dsound proc named "DllCanUnloadNow"
"DllCanUnloadNow" hooked, address 0x592F73D0
Hooking dsound proc named "DllGetClassObject"
"DllGetClassObject" hooked, address 0x592F0730
Hooking dsound proc named "DirectSoundCaptureCreate"
"DirectSoundCaptureCreate" hooked, address 0x5930EFA0
Hooking dsound proc named "DirectSoundCaptureEnumerateA"
"DirectSoundCaptureEnumerateA" hooked, address 0x5930F060
Hooking dsound proc named "DirectSoundCaptureEnumerateW"
"DirectSoundCaptureEnumerateW" hooked, address 0x5930F080
Hooking dsound proc named "GetDeviceID"
"GetDeviceID" hooked, address 0x5930F3B0
Hooking dsound proc named "DirectSoundFullDuplexCreate"
"DirectSoundFullDuplexCreate" hooked, address 0x5930F0E0
Hooking dsound proc named "DirectSoundCreate8"
"DirectSoundCreate8" hooked, address 0x592FC270
Hooking dsound proc named "DirectSoundCaptureCreate8"
"DirectSoundCaptureCreate8" hooked, address 0x5930EED0
Loading ASI C:\Program Files (x86)\Steam\steamapps\common\Grand Theft Auto IV\GTAIV\FirstPerson.asi
ASI loaded : C:\Program Files (x86)\Steam\steamapps\common\Grand Theft Auto IV\GTAIV\FirstPerson.asi, Address 0x514D0000
Loading ASI C:\Program Files (x86)\Steam\steamapps\common\Grand Theft Auto IV\GTAIV\ScriptHookDotNet.asi
ASI loaded : C:\Program Files (x86)\Steam\steamapps\common\Grand Theft Auto IV\GTAIV\ScriptHookDotNet.asi, Address 0x510C0000

2017-05-24 19:29:58 - Initializing ScriptHookDotNet v1.7.1.7 BETA (on GTA IV version 1.0.7.0 with C++ Hook version 0.5.1)
2017-05-24 19:31:34 - Direct3D device created!

2017-05-24 19:31:35 - SEARCHING FOR SCRIPTS...
2017-05-24 19:31:35 - DONE! No DotNet script found!
2017-05-24 19:31:35 - INFO: Phone number checks are not available!
2017-05-24 19:31:52 - Direct3D device lost!

Log start: Wed May 24 19:29:58 2017
-----------------------------------------------
[INFO] GTA IV Script Hook 0.5.1 - (C) 2009, Aru - Initialized
[INFO] Process base address: 0xb80000
[INFO] Auto detecting game version
[INFO] Using game version 1.0.7
[INFO] [ScriptHookDotNet] Thread started
[INFO] [ScriptHookDotNet] Thread killed
[INFO] Script Hook - Shutdown

Log start: Wed May 24 19:29:58 2017
-----------------------------------------------
[INFO] GTA IV Script Hook 0.3.0c - Initialized
[INFO] Process base address: 0xb80000
[INFO] Using game version 3.0.1
[INFO] Awaiting game thread creation
[INFO] Script Hook - Shutdown

Log start: Wed May 24 19:29:58 2017
-----------------------------------------------
[INFO] GTA IV Script Hook 0.5.1 - (C) 2009, Aru - Initialized
[INFO] Process base address: 0xb80000
[INFO] Auto detecting game version
[INFO] Using game version 1.0.7
[INFO] [ScriptHookDotNet] Thread started
[INFO] [ScriptHookDotNet] Thread killed
[INFO] Script Hook - Shutdown





Last edited by captainnick14; May 24, 2017 @ 4:37pm
Originally posted by captainnick14:
I can't get the first person mod to work. I have dsound.dll and scripthook.dll. What is wrong?
bump
< >
Showing 1-7 of 7 comments
Per page: 1530 50